Job description

Job Description
Job Title: Laser Operator
Job Description

This role focuses on setting up and operating a 15k fiber laser cutting machine, ensuring efficient production, accurate cuts, and a clean, safe work area within a modern manufacturing environment.

Responsibilities
  • Set up and run a 15k fiber laser cutting machine, specifically a Mazak fiber laser, according to job specifications.
  • Configure and operate laser cutting machines to produce parts that meet quality and dimensional requirements.
  • Operate the load/unload system to safely and efficiently move sheet materials to and from the laser cutting equipment.
  • Pull sheet materials using a forklift and stage them for production runs.
  • Maintain the laser machines and surrounding areas in a clean, organized, and safe condition.
  • Perform tasks and provide support in other departments as needed to assist overall production operations.
  • Read and interpret blueprints to ensure accurate setup and cutting operations.
  • Lift and move materials weighing 50 pounds or more as required for machine setup and material handling.
  • Participate in offsite training for approximately one week to enhance skills and knowledge related to laser setup and operation.
Essential Skills
  • At least 1 year of experience setting up a laser, with fiber laser experience preferred.
  • Hands-on experience setting up and running laser cutting machines.
  • Ability to operate a load/unload system for laser cutting equipment.
  • Ability to pull and move materials using a forklift.
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ints accurately.
  • Capability to lift 50 pounds or more safely and repeatedly.
  • Basic laser operation skills, including familiarity with Mazak laser equipment.
Additional Skills & Qualifications
  • Experience with fiber laser technology is highly preferred.
  • Blueprint reading proficiency to support accurate setups and quality control.
  • Willingness and ability to travel for approximately one week for offsite training.
  • Interest in learning setups and programming for laser equipment.
  • Motivation to grow within a manufacturing environment and explore different departments over time.
Why Work Here?

The organization offers a comprehensive benefits package that includes medical, dental, health savings account, life, disability, and accident insurance, along with a 401(k) plan featuring employer matching up to 4%. Team members can earn a perfect attendance bonus and enjoy access to onsite gym and workout facilities, including a basketball court. The company supports a four-day workweek, promotes from within, and is flexible with daycare and shift needs. Employees have opportunities to learn setups and programming, benefit from a strong focus on work-life balance, and enjoy a comfortable environment where listening to music is allowed and the facility is air conditioned.

Work Environment

The role is based in a large, air-conditioned shop in the Maple Lake area. The facility utilizes 15k fiber laser cutting machines, including Mazak equipment, along with load/unload systems and forklifts for material handling. The environment supports a four-day workweek and offers onsite gym and workout facilities, including a basketball court. The culture encourages a relaxed yet professional atmosphere where employees can listen to music while working, and there is a strong emphasis on work-life balance. The position involves physical activity, including lifting 50 pounds or more and working on the shop floor with industrial machinery.
